September 19, 2023 - Alluring nose of crushed raspberries, forest floor moss, intriguing loamy minerals. Fruit is there, but balanced with dried currents, ripe plum, and herbal undertones. The palate is like nose-balanced diminutive berries with forest floor bamble bush that leads to a full, long finish Not a typical Kosta Browne with bombastic fruit, but a reserved respectable well crafted Pinot with intermingle of earth, herbs, berries. All in balanced with long finish.
